Ameriprise Financial Inc. bought a new position in shares of Mid Penn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:MPB - Free Report) in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und bought 13,700 shares of the financial services provider's stock, valued at approximately $395,000. Ameriprise Financial Inc. owned about 0.07% of Mid Penn Bancorp at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Mid Penn Bancorp, Inc operates as the bank holding company for Mid Penn Bank that provides commercial banking services to individuals, partnerships, non-profit organizations, and corporations. The company offers various time and demand deposit products, including checking accounts, savings accounts, clubs, money market deposit accounts, certificates of deposit, and individual retirement accounts.
